Abstract

A kind of telescopic insulating flat cable.By spring stratum reticulare threaded tree fat big envelope element; by elasticity and the retractility traction resin encapsulation element formation cover stack structure of spring stratum reticulare; resin encapsulation element internal forms oval installation axle track; the installing space of electric wire is provided; form protecting sheathing by the structure of intussusception in electric wire outside, according to its coverage of length requirement telescopic adjustment of electric wire, the flat cable with flexible structure can be formed further; be convenient to install on framework is laid and fix, prospect of the application is more wide.

Embodiment
In FIG, telescopic insulating flat cable 1 has the flat shell of intussusception 2, shell 2 forms cover stack structure by multiple resin encapsulation element 3, resin encapsulation element 3 inside is oval hollow structure, laterally form the installation axle track 4 of internal wire cable, form between each separate unit of resin encapsulation element 3 and mutually overlap stack structure, between connected by spring stratum reticulare 5, spring stratum reticulare 5 is as the syndeton between resin encapsulation element 3, head and the tail are connected between two resin encapsulation elements 3, network structure forms spring layer, resin encapsulation element 3 is connected by spring stratum reticulare 5, by elasticity and the retractility traction resin encapsulation element 3 formation cover stack structure of spring stratum reticulare 5, 3, resin encapsulation unit is inner forms oval installation axle track 4, the installing space of electric wire 6 is provided, protecting sheathing is formed in electric wire 6 outside by the structure of intussusception, further can according to its coverage of length requirement telescopic adjustment of electric wire 6, form the flat cable with flexible structure, be convenient to install on framework is laid and fix, realize the valid function of telescopic insulating flat cable 1.

Claims (2)

1. a telescopic insulating flat cable, cable has the flat shell of intussusception, it is characterized in that, shell forms cover stack structure by multiple resin encapsulation element, resin encapsulation element internal is oval hollow structure, laterally form the installation axle track of internal wire cable, form between each separate unit of resin encapsulation element and mutually overlap stack structure, between connected by spring stratum reticulare.
2. telescopic insulating flat cable according to claim 1, is characterized in that: spring stratum reticulare is as the syndeton between resin encapsulation element, and head and the tail are connected between two resin encapsulation elements, and network structure forms spring layer.
